Redpath outraged by bomb alert at Lisburn school

Responding to news that 600 children have had to been moved out of a Lisburn primary school after a bomb scare, Cllr Alex Redpath, the Ulster Unionist Party candidate for Lagan Valley said:

 “I am appalled and disgusted by news that Pond Park Primary School has been evacuated this morning.

 “I have spoken to parents this morning and they are concerned and very angry that their children have been subject to such disruption.

 “If this is confirmed as being a deliberately left device, or even if it turns out to be a hoax, I would urge the entire community to work with the police to identify the culprit or culprits. 

 “What is absolutely clear is that anyone who would deliberately target a primary school needs to be taken off the streets and put behind bars as soon as possible.  This incident has echoes of our troubled past, which we are trying to leave behind.”
